**Alert: Config hot-reload failed**

Heads up — Fernwheel tried to hot-reload your plugin's config and something didn't stick. Usually this means a malformed value or a key that can't be changed without a restart. Your plugin keeps running on the old config, so nothing's broken yet. For the list of reloadable keys and debugging tips, check the internal page here.

runbook for badug-kadup: https://confluence.zemvarlabs.internal/projects/browse/display/projects/bd1b

TURN-208: Gatevale turnstile counters at the Merrow Field pilot double-count when a rotation reverses mid-cycle. Attendance totals drift roughly 2% high per event. The debounce window fix is implemented, reviewed by Ilsa, and soak-tested across two simulated match days without drift. Ready for your cut; the candidate build is identified below.

trace token, tagag-tafog: htk6_5ed18c

**Ticket VLT-2281: Expired credentials blocking KeyChurn rotation run**

The nightly KeyChurn rotation job on the Drossfield cluster failed at 02:14 because the service account credential it uses to authenticate against VaultPine expired yesterday. Until the account is re-provisioned, downstream consumers (Ledgerbird, Mothwing) are pinned to stale secrets. Please verify the rotation schedule in the KeyChurn config before re-running, and confirm no partial writes occurred. For the interim, use the temporary key issued below.

gateway credential: kto23_LX9A4ys6i4nzHtpOLNLodKK

Handover — Vexler partner SFTP drop

Ownership moves to you today. Drop runs hourly from Vexler's end into the intake bucket via the relay host. Watch for zero-byte files; their exporter flakes on Mondays. Creds live in the ops vault, path noted in the runbook. Vault auto-seals after 48h idle. Support escalations go to the on-call rotation, not me. If the vault is sealed when you need it, unseal with the recovery passphrase below.

recovery phrase for tadug-fafof: zorwyn-kasion